The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of William Fligg, born in 1824 in Snaith, Yorkshire, consisted of 3 members. William was the head of the household, married to Fanny Fligg, born in 1830 in Sheffield, Yorksh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was William's Boarder, William Shirtliffe, born in 1842 in Nottinghamshire, England.
